Abstract
Microgrids have attracted global attentions in the recent years. Configuration and evaluation are the main contents of a microgrid at early stage. In this paper, an integrated approach for configuration optimization and economic evaluation for microgrids is proposed. The configuration is formulated as an optimization problem, which takes the annual cost as its objective and considers the constraints from capacity, power balance and operation protection. Moreover, the economic factors, as government subsidy, discount rate and unit cost of power sources are investigated in the economic evaluation of microgrid. Two spots in Wuhan are used to establish microgrid scenarios to test the validity of the integrated configuration and evaluation approach. The convincing results of the microgrid scenarios will be presented.
